Steel Plate Venture Planned: Nissho Iwai Corp., Japan’s sixth-largest trading company, will form a joint venture with Vietnam Steel Corp. and a Malaysian trading company to process steel plates in Vietnam. Establishment of Vinanic Steel Processing Co. will cost $600,000, with Vietnam Steel investing $300,000, a Nissho Iwai spokeswoman said last week. Nissho Iwai will provide 30% of the investment, and Malaysian company SMPC Metal Industries will provide the remaining 20%. The spokeswoman said the plant, which is scheduled to begin operating in the fall of 1996, will be Vietnam’s first steel plate processing operation.
